I joined Catalyst 2030 because of its unwavering commitment to solving the world’s most pressing social and environmental challenges through collaboration and systemic change. As the CEO and Founder of Philemon Farm Enterprise, I have seen the power of collective action in creating sustainable solutions, especially in the areas of food security, job creation, and environmental conservation.
At Philemon Farm Enterprise, we train individuals in mushroom farming, provide free mushroom seeds, and create jobs that help alleviate malnutrition and poverty. We also contribute to environmental sustainability by making charcoal briquettes from expired mushroom seeds, addressing ecosystem degradation and climate change.
Catalyst 2030 offers a global platform that connects like-minded changemakers, fostering innovation and partnerships that can amplify our work. By joining, I aim to learn from others, share insights, and collaborate on impactful projects that will drive meaningful change, not just in my community but globally.
Through Catalyst 2030, I am confident that I will have the opportunity to expand my network, access valuable resources, and contribute to shaping a more equitable and sustainable future for all.

I joined Catalyst Now because I believe real change happens through collaboration, not in silos. As the founder of Reformation Community, my work centers on empowering youth to solve systemic problems through leadership, innovation, and education. From launching university chapters across Ghana to using storytelling for advocacy through Reel Change, I’ve seen how grassroots efforts can drive impact—but I’ve also recognized the limits of working alone.
Catalyst Now offers a powerful global community committed to systems change—challenging root causes, shifting power, and reimagining what impact looks like. I joined to connect with fellow change-makers, share Africa’s voice in global conversations, and contribute meaningfully to a movement that’s actively shaping a more just and sustainable world.
